I've been trying to get my new 93 940 with Regina ready for a 2nd emission check after a failed 1st (high CO, HC and NOx at 40 km/h). The car started and idled well but seemed to miss at around 2000 - 2500 rpms and chug on deceleration. Even though the car looks well maintained, I think the previous owner let some basics slide and did not drive the car much recently. Here's what I've done:
-checked and cleared coded, nothing came back
-new rotor and cap, old rotor was pitted
-new plugs, old ones had evidence of a rich condition especially cylinders 2 and 3
-checked for vaccuum leaks and ended up tightening most of the valve cover and intake nuts
-unplugged every sensor and checked contacts
-checked all grounds
-tested O2 sensor
-oil change, oil looked old
-the whole exhaust from the Y pipe on looks almost new
After all this the car ran better and gas mileage improved but still some missing at 2000 rpms. Then I swapped in a different RSR and the engine missed worse at 2000rpms - aha, I said and swapped in another one and the engine ran much better. Later today I'll find out if that did the trick with regard to emissions testing.
